'''Friends''' is a menu that allows the player to create an online lobby or join a friend's lobby.<!-- can you join party match lobbies from this menu? --> When creating a lobby, players can choose whether or not to require a code to join the lobby. After creating a lobby, it can be customized with any set of rules the player desires. The lobby can be set to either [[Party Match]] or [[Arena]].
